The Pillars of Power: Current Ram Engine Offerings

In the United States, Ram truck purchasers typically choose their engine based upon a specific balance of fuel economy, pulling needs, and preliminary cost. Currently, the lineup consists of the dependable Pentastar V6, the renowned HEMI V8, and the industrial-grade Cummins Turbo Diesel.

1. The 3.6 L Pentastar V6 with eTorque

The Pentastar V6 functions as the entry-level engine for the Ram 1500. Far from being "underpowered," this engine uses an eTorque mild-hybrid system. This system replaces the standard alternator with a belt-driven motor generator unit that deals with a 48-volt battery pack to enhance fuel effectiveness and supply seamless start/stop performance.

  • Best For: Daily driving, light-duty carrying, and fuel-conscious commuters.

2. The 5.7 L HEMI ® V8

No engine is more carefully related to the Dodge Ram tradition than the HEMI. For over twenty years, the 5.7 L HEMI has actually been the gold standard for half-ton trucks. Understood for its distinct exhaust note and "Hemi-spherical" combustion chambers, this engine delivers the "muscle vehicle" feel that numerous truck enthusiasts long for.

  • Best For: All-around energy, heavy towing in the 1500 class, and high-speed highway combining.

3. The 6.7 L Cummins ® Turbo Diesel

When it concerns the Heavy Duty (2500 and 3500) segments, the Cummins name is famous. This inline-six engine is developed for durability and extreme torque. It is the engine of choice for hot-shot haulers and ranchers who require to pull trailers going beyond 30,000 pounds.

  • Best For: Professional towing, commercial use, and optimum longevity.

The New Frontier: The Hurricane Twin-Turbo Inline-6

The most significant shift in the USA Dodge Ram engine market is the introduction of the "Hurricane" engine household. As emission regulations tighten and consumer need for efficiency grows, Ram is transitioning far from the V8 architecture in its 1500 models.

The Hurricane engine is a 3.0-liter Twin-Turbocharged Inline-Six (SST). In spite of having smaller displacement than the HEMI, it produces considerably more horse power and torque. By utilizing 2 low-inertia turbochargers, the engine provides almost instant throttle reaction, making it feel more effective than the V8s it changes.

Secret Features of the Hurricane Engine:

  • Plasma Transfer Wire Arc (PTWA) Coating: Used in the cylinder tires to minimize friction.
  • High-Pressure Direct Injection: Optimizes fuel atomization for better combustion.
  • Weight Reduction: The aluminum block is lighter than the cast iron blocks of old, enhancing front-rear weight distribution.

Upkeep and Reliability

For American truck owners, dependability is the main issue. Dodge Ram engines are typically crafted for high mileage, provided they receive proper upkeep.

Common Maintenance Needs:

  • The "Hemi Tick": Owners of the 5.7 L V8 typically report a ticking sound. This is often connected to broken manifold bolts or lifter concerns. Routine oil modifications with high-quality synthetic oil can mitigate these risks.
  • Diesel Emissions Systems: The 6.7 L Cummins requires Diesel Exhaust Fluid (DEF). Ensuring the Selective Catalytic Reduction (SCR) system is functioning is important to avoid "limp mode."
  • eTorque Battery Cooling: For V6 and V8 models geared up with eTorque, ensuring the devoted cooling system for the 48V battery is functioning is vital for long-lasting electronics health.

The Future: Electrification and the RAM REV

The landscape of the Dodge Ram engine in the USA is changing. While internal combustion stays dominant, the "engine" of the future for Ram is a dual-motor electric setup.

  1. RAM 1500 REV: This all-electric design looks for to challenge the status quo with a targeted 500-mile range.
  2. RAM 1500 Ramcharger: This is a distinct "Range Extended" vehicle. It features a standard Pentastar V6 engine, however the engine is not linked to the wheels. Rather, it serves as an onboard generator to charge the battery, offering the benefit of gas with the torque of an EV.

Regularly Asked Questions (FAQ)

1. Is Dodge Ram Truck Engine Part V8 being ceased in Dodge Ram trucks?

Yes, for the Ram 1500 (half-ton) model, the 5.7 L HEMI is being phased out in favor of the 3.0 L Hurricane Twin-Turbo Inline-6 engine. However, the HEMI remains available in the utilized market and in specific Heavy Duty configurations for the time being.

2. Which Ram engine is best for fuel economy?

The 3.6 L Pentastar V6 with eTorque provides the finest gasoline-only fuel economy. For long-distance highway carrying with heavy loads, the 6.7 L Cummins Diesel often supplies the best effectiveness relative to the work it performs.

3. For how long do Cummins Diesel engines usually last?

With meticulous maintenance, 6.7 L Cummins engines are known to last in between 300,000 and 500,000 miles before requiring a major overhaul.

4. What is the distinction in between the requirement and High Output (HO) Cummins?

The High Output (HO) variation is normally discovered in the Ram 3500. It features a various turbocharger and internal parts that enable it to reach over 1,000 lb-ft of torque, whereas the basic version is tuned for somewhat lower output to balance fuel economy and transmission longevity.

5. Why did Ram switch to an Inline-6 "Hurricane" engine?

The relocate to an Inline-6 permits for lower emissions and better fuel economy than a V8, while the twin-turbocharging technology offers more power. In addition, inline engines are naturally balanced, causing smoother operation.
